What is an operations support manager?

An operations support manager oversees the operational support team and provides high-level technical support for customers and staff. As an operations support manager, your job duties include supervising employees, assessing the efficiency and technical proficiency of the team, and ensuring staff safety when working in potentially hazardous settings like a plant. You may also direct the department in resolving operational issues and monitor daily workflows to ensure operational needs are met. The career typically requires at least a bachelor’s degree in a relevant field, such as business administration or operations management, and on-the-job training. Employers may also require prior leadership experience or knowledge of a specific industry. Additional qualifications include strong interpersonal, technical, and data analysis skills, as well as the ability to manage others.

What is the difference between Operations Support Manager vs Operations Coordinator?

AspectOperations Support ManagerOperations Coordinator
CredentialsTypically requires a bachelor's degree in business, management, or related field; certifications like PMP can be beneficialUsually requires a high school diploma or associate degree; some roles prefer relevant certifications or coursework
Work EnvironmentOversees multiple teams or departments, often in office settings, managing operational processesSupports daily operations, often working closely with teams on specific tasks or projects
Employer & Industry UsageCommon in logistics, manufacturing, and corporate sectorsWidely used in retail, healthcare, and service industries

The Operations Support Manager focuses on overseeing operational processes and managing teams, requiring more experience and credentials. In contrast, the Operations Coordinator handles supporting tasks and daily activities, often in entry-level roles. Both roles are essential for smooth operations but differ in scope and responsibilities.

Job description

The Operations Support Specialist provides operational and administrative support to the Geospatial Customer Success and Operations team. This role is responsible for processing warranty and annual maintenance orders submitted by the Customer Success Team, Sales Team, and customers, while also supporting purchasing activities and the creation of end-customer warranty certificates. The position plays a key role in ensuring accurate, timely, and efficient service delivery.
Summary of Job Duties

  • Process warranty and annual maintenance orders submitted by the Customer Success Team, Sales Team, and customers.
  • Purchase inventory required to fulfill warranty and annual maintenance orders.
  • Register customer information to serial numbers to ensure accurate warranty coverage.
  • Prepare warranty documentation for the Customer Success Team to present to customers.
  • Partner with the Team Lead to maintain virtual warranty inventory and ensure timely, accurate warranty assignments.
  • Participate in monthly virtual inventory reviews with the Team Lead and Shared Services Manager and reconcile counts with ERP records.
  • Prepare weekly, monthly, and quarterly reports as directed by the Team Lead and Shared Services Manager.
  • Perform other duties as assigned by the Team Lead.
